Amazing Passover Chocolate Toffee Matzo might be just the hor d'oeuvre you are searching for. This recipe serves 30. One portion of this dish contains roughly 2g of protein, 15g of fat, and a total of 225 calories. Head to the store and pick up butter, matzos, pecans, and a few other things to make it today. From preparation to the plate, this recipe takes approximately 1 hour and 25 minutes.
